logo

Output 61b8fd05d38f55c52830047af967a748cd5b8183efc725c4d2c87ddbfd239368:1

value
15278659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bb73439284524a572fb71d20f7554b5bf53b82 OP_EQUAL
address
3Htn5mac1Q1PT1erozXnjYZh858hj2vryV
transaction
61b8fd05d38f55c52830047af967a748cd5b8183efc725c4d2c87ddbfd239368